Web19 sep. 2014 · If your tom drums are lacking thump then make a boost around 100Hz-250Hz. The attack brings up the rhythmic nature of the tom and makes it cut through a mix, making it more audible and present. To add more attack then boost around 3kHz-5kHz. As the primary rhythmic instrument, drums are the … WebAnother element to consider is the 'width' (or better put spatialness, openness or dynamic nature) of the drums in the front of house mix. Creating that sense of width can often be achieved with a couple of overhead condenser mics / pencil mics and then some extra 'width' added to the mix via simple pan / balance adjustments.

Web1 aug. 2024 · Grab a mic and position it roughly 5 feet high and 8 feet or so right in front of the kit. The balance will be a lot more natural, but you will hear a lot more of the room sound. Hopefully the room sounds great and adds to the size and power of the kit! You might want to try this method first when recording drums with one mic. Over the drummer ... Wood struck by lightning and buffalo hide are being used to build three large traditional drums at Shingwauk Kinoomaage Gamig as ... WebDrum Miking Cheat Sheet. To minimize room sound, lower the OH microphones and point them toward the center of the kit. To maximize room sound, raise the OH microphones, angle them away from the drums, or use wider polar patterns. To minimize cymbal sound, try Recorderman. For the widest possible stereo spread, use AB.
